Individual cognitive stimulation at home

Cognitive stimulation plays a significant role in the management of neurodegenerative diseases such as Alzheimer's disease, Parkinson's disease, frontotemporal dementia, and other similar conditions. This therapy focuses on maintaining and improving cognitive functions, quality of life, and independence for patients as they face the challenges of these progressive diseases. Here are some key aspects of cognitive stimulation in this context:


  1. Personalization of treatment.
  2. Memory exercises.
  3. Attention and concentration exercises.
  4. Executive function training.
  5. Language and communication therapy.
  6. Sensory stimulation.
  7. Emotional support.
  8. Continuous monitoring.


In summary, cognitive stimulation is an essential part of managing neurodegenerative diseases. It provides a way to maintain and improve cognitive function, quality of life, and independence for patients as they face the challenges of these diseases. This therapy is tailored to individual needs and is an important component of a comprehensive approach to caring for people with neurodegenerative diseases.
